Fire in National Museum put out
Updated: 2014-03-30-10:27
A fire broke out in a gallery of the Bangladesh National Museum at Dhaka’s Shahbagh on Sunday morning but was controlled soon after.
Officials said it broke out in gallery number 44 on the third floor of the museum around 9am.
According to the museum website, the gallery hosts token of China, Korea, Iran and Switzerland as part of world civilisation.
Fire Service Director General Quamrun Nahar Khanam said several officials informed the fire service post-haste when they saw smoke in the third floor.
The firefighters were able to put it out within 30 minutes.
Culture Secretary Ranjit Kumar Biswas rushed to the museum on hearing of the fire.
He said an investigation committee would be formed to investigate how the fire broke out.
Fire service officials could not immediately ascertain the cause of the fire.
Museum’s Director Mahbubur Rahman said the fire spread in the museum’s gallery number 44, but he said no major damage has been caused.
Khanam also insisted none of the artefacts had been damaged.
Rahman assumed an electric short-circuit had caused the fire.
The office hour at the museum starts at 9am like in other public institutions.
